The Festivals
The UK is a treasure trove of outdoor music festivals, each one unique and captivating in its own way. Here are five of the most secretive and enchanting ones that are sure to leave you spellbound:
1. Secret Garden Party
Located in the picturesque countryside of Cambridgeshire, Secret Garden Party is a four-day extravaganza that defies conventions. By combining music, art, and performance, this festival creates an immersive experience that will leave you breathless. With a focus on electronic and indie music, it’s the perfect haven for those who crave something truly unique.
2. Shambala Festival
Imagine a seven-day celebration of music, art, and wellbeing, set amidst the breathtaking Northamptonshire countryside. Shambala Festival is a true gem, offering an eclectic mix of genres that will cater to every musical taste. From folk to electronic, and with a strong emphasis on sustainability, this festival is a must-visit for those who care deeply about the planet and its people.
